The Fredericktown Black Cats are on the road again on Thursday to play the DeSoto Dragons at 7:00 p.m. Fredericktown will be strutting in after a win while DeSoto will be coming in after a defeat.
Last Tuesday, it was close, but Fredericktown sidestepped Scott City for a 3-2 victory.
Fredericktown took Scott City into a fifth set where they got it done with a seven-point win. After all that action, the final score was 19-25, 25-13, 25-16, 22-25, 15-8.
Meanwhile, DeSoto didn't have quite enough to beat Central on Tuesday and fell 3-2.
DeSoto took Central into a fifth set but they suffered a heartbreaking four-point loss. The final score came out to 21-25, 25-18, 19-25, 25-18, 15-11.
Fredericktown's win was their third straight on the road, which pushed their record up to 3-0. As for DeSoto, they now have a losing record at 1-2-1.
Fredericktown skirted past DeSoto 2-1 in their previous matchup back in September of 2021. Does Fredericktown have another victory up their sleeve, or will DeSoto tur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
